Understanding Protein Powder and Its Benefits

Protein powder is a dietary supplement that provides a concentrated source of protein. It is commonly used by athletes, bodybuilders, and anyone looking to boost their protein intake. Here are some benefits of including protein powder in your nutrition:

  • Muscle Growth: Protein is essential for repairing and building muscle tissue.
  • Convenience: Protein powders are easy to prepare and can be consumed on the go.
  • Weight Management: Protein can help you feel full longer, aiding in weight loss or maintenance.
  • Nutritional Support: Protein powders can supplement your diet, providing essential amino acids.

Walmart’s Selection of Protein Powders

Walmart is known for its comprehensive range of health products and supplements, including protein powders. Shoppers can find various options, from popular brand names to store-brand alternatives. Here’s what you need to know about Walmart’s protein powder offerings:

  • Types of Protein Powder: Walmart offers several types of protein powders, including:
    • Whey Protein: Fast-absorbing, ideal for post-workout recovery.
    • Casein Protein: Slow-digesting, perfect for overnight muscle recovery.
    • Plant-Based Protein: Options like pea, hemp, and brown rice protein for vegan diets.
    • Egg Protein: A high-quality animal protein source for those avoiding dairy.
  • Brands Available: Walmart carries a variety of trusted brands, including:
    • Optimum Nutrition
    • Body Fortress
    • Orgain
    • Vega
    • Walmart’s Great Value brand
  • Price Range: Prices vary, but Walmart typically offers competitive rates, making it an affordable option for those looking to purchase protein powder.

Common Concerns About Protein Powder

Many people have questions or concerns regarding the use of protein powder. Here are some frequently asked questions:

Is Protein Powder Safe?

For most people, protein powder is safe when consumed in moderation. However, those with specific medical conditions should consult a healthcare provider before starting any supplement.

Can I Get Enough Protein Without Supplements?

Yes, it is possible to meet your protein needs through whole foods like meat, dairy, eggs, legumes, and nuts. Protein powder is simply a convenient option for those with higher protein requirements.

Are There Any Side Effects?

Some individuals may experience digestive issues like bloating or gas. It’s essential to start with a smaller serving and increase gradually to assess tolerance.
